Population
| Metric | Golden Gate | Florida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 28,866 | 22,318,419 | 334,821,731 |
| Population density (per sq mi) | 7021.4 | 312.4 | 85.8 |
| Population growth (%/yr) | -0.05% | 1.35% | 0.57% |
| Median age | 35.5 | 40.2 | 37.1 |
| Households | 8,099 | 8,536,315 | 128,459,983 |
Population in Golden Gate grew by 18.8% from 2009 to 2023, reaching 28,764 in 2023.

Economy
Golden Gate has a the economy index of D, which means it is barely prosperous.
| Metric | Golden Gate | Florida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median household income | $63,953 | $71,865 | $78,145 |
| Income growth (%/yr) | 6.04% | 5.65% | 5.07% |
| Unemployment rate | 3.7% | 4.8% | 5.2% |
The median household income in Golden Gate is about 11% lower than in Florida.
Housing
| Metric | Golden Gate | Florida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median home price | $387,097 | $293,727 | $242,182 |
| Median rent | $1,640 | $1,564 | $1,342 |
| Homeownership rate | 54.4% | 67.3% | 65.1% |
The median home price in Golden Gate is about 19.7 years' worth of rent — buying at the median price costs roughly as much as paying the median rent of $1,640 per month for that long.
Commute Time & Mobility
Commuters in Golden Gate spend about 43 minutes on the road round trip each working day. Over a typical 250-day work year, that adds up to roughly 181 hours, about 7.5 full days, spent commuting.
| Metric | Golden Gate | Florida Avg | U.S.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| One-way commute (min) | 21.7 | 23.9 | 22.5 |
| Round-trip commute (min) | 43.5 | 47.9 | 44.9 |
| Yearly time spent (hours) | 181 | 200 | 187 |
| Estimated yearly cost | $5,613 | $6,185 | $5,803 |
| Work from home | 7.3% | 13.9% | 13.4% |
| Highway traffic (vehicles/day) | 18,896 | 14,318 | 8,813 |
| Local road traffic (vehicles/day) | 5,361 | 3,068 | 1,355 |
The average commute time in Golden Gate is 22 minutes, shorter than the 24 minutes in Florida.
Estimated yearly cost applies a single national wage rule of thumb (U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ics average hourly earnings), not a measurement of wages in this area. Traffic volume figures come from proprietary Ticon and TrafficZoom data.
